Browse Local Businesses Near You

Use our filters to find the right business for your needs. NearBizMap connects you with trusted local companies and services in your area.

Businesses in St Albans

Rami Tandoori, St Albans

4.2(99 reviews)
305 Watford Rd, St Albans AL2 3DA, United Kingdom